Dentists, General salary: Minnesota vs South Carolina

Occupation

Dentists, General in Minnesota earn a median of $219,200. In South Carolina, $158,640. After cost-of-living, the gap is 31.3% — not 38.2%.

Nominal pay gap
+38.2%
Minnesota vs South Carolina
COL-adjusted gap
+31.3%
After BEA Regional Price Parities
